Teaching English as a Second Language (ESL) can be a rewarding yet challenging endeavor As an ESL teacher, it is important to utilize effective strategies to help students learn and improve their language skills In this article, we will discuss some proven ESL teaching strategies that can help you create engaging and effective lessons for your students.

1 Use a Communicative Approach: One of the key principles of ESL teaching is the communicative approach, which focuses on language use in real-life situations Instead of just memorizing grammar rules and vocabulary, students are encouraged to communicate with each other in meaningful ways This can include role-plays, group discussions, debates, and other interactive activities that promote language use in authentic contexts.

2 Incorporate Multisensory Activities: ESL students often have varying learning styles, so it is important to incorporate multisensory activities into your lessons This can include using visual aids, hands-on activities, music, and movement to engage students and help them retain information better For example, you can use flashcards, videos, and songs to teach vocabulary and pronunciation, or have students act out dialogues to practice speaking skills.

3 Provide Contextualized Input: When teaching new language concepts, it is important to provide contextualized input that connects the language to real-life situations This can help students understand the meaning and use of language in context, which can improve their comprehension and retention For example, you can use authentic materials such as newspaper articles, songs, or videos to teach vocabulary and grammar in meaningful ways.

4 Encourage Language Production: To help students improve their speaking and writing skills, it is important to encourage language production in the classroom This can include activities such as group discussions, debates, storytelling, and writing prompts that require students to use the language in meaningful ways esl teaching strategies. Providing opportunities for students to practice speaking and writing can help them gain confidence and fluency in English.

5 Use Differentiated Instruction: ESL students come from diverse linguistic and cultural backgrounds, so it is important to use differentiated instruction to meet their individual needs This can include adapting your teaching methods, materials, and assessments to accommodate different learning styles, language proficiency levels, and cultural preferences By providing a personalized learning experience, you can help each student succeed in their language learning journey.

6 Provide Feedback and Correction: Giving feedback and correction is essential in ESL teaching to help students improve their language skills When students make mistakes, it is important to provide constructive feedback that helps them understand the error and how to correct it This can include providing corrective input, examples, and opportunities for practice to reinforce the correct language use Additionally, providing positive reinforcement and encouragement can motivate students to continue learning and improving.

7 Foster a Supportive Learning Environment: Creating a supportive and inclusive learning environment is crucial in ESL teaching to help students feel comfortable and motivated to learn Encourage collaboration, respect, and empathy among students, and create a safe space for them to make mistakes and take risks in their language learning By fostering a positive classroom climate, you can help students build confidence, develop their language skills, and reach their full potential.

In conclusion, ESL teaching strategies play a key role in helping students learn and improve their English language skills By incorporating communicative approaches, multisensory activities, contextualized input, language production, differentiated instruction, feedback and correction, and fostering a supportive learning environment, ESL teachers can create engaging and effective lessons that cater to the diverse needs of their students With the right strategies and techniques, ESL teachers can empower their students to become confident and proficient English language learners.
